Italy and France sign space technology cooperation agreements
During the International Space Summit at the Grand Palais in Paris, Italian and French companies signed two industrial agreements to strengthen space sector cooperation. The deals focus on artificial intelligence and optical satellite communications.
The first partnership between Sopra Steria/CS GROUP and the Italian firm AIKO aims to integrate advanced AI technologies into European platforms for managing space operations. This collaboration seeks to increase automation, improve satellite data analysis, and support decision-making processes for mission management.
The second agreement is a Memorandum of Understanding between Leaf Space and the French company Cailabs. This partnership focuses on integrating high-capacity optical satellite links into ground segment services, which provide the terrestrial infrastructure necessary for communicating with satellites.
High-level officials attended the signing, including Italy’s Minister of Enterprises and Made in Italy, Adolfo Urso, and France’s Minister Delegate for Europe, Benjamin Haddad. Urso noted that the cooperation aims to build a more competitive and sovereign European space industry.
